The Glorious Knight watch draws its inspiration from the world of sports and is essentially targeted at a young, dynamic and "sporty-chic" clientele.
The combination of steel and black PVD on a 46 mm case reinforces the contemporary spirit of the watch. The imperial column motif, a tribute to the historical legacy of the DeWitt family, is still present, but in a more understated way. The curved case is fitted on a metal or rubber strap.
The Glorious Knight Chronograph is equipped with a function displaying the hours, minutes, seconds and chronograph. The chronograph minute counter in the centre of the dial takes form of a turning disc with an open aperture that reveals the countdown of the minutes as it turns.
The hour and minute hands in 18-carat white gold are openwork and sword-shaped. Those on the counters are illuminated by a golden hue at their tip. The power reserve is approximately 42 hours.

Equipped with a patented and totally avant-garde system, the crown, engraved with the "W" logo, is inverted. The crown tilts back to its normal position for setting the watch.
The dials on the Glorious Knight Chronograph are crafted in their entirety at the Manufacture. They evoke the dashboard of a sports car with two dials at 3 and 9 o'clock connected by an "grille" balancing the ensemble.
The new Glorious Knight line meets the high standards of finish adopted by the DeWitt Manufacture since its creation: satin-finished, polished and chamfered surfaces. The high quality of finishing work also applies to the oscillating weight with personalised "Côtes de Genève", and to the case back stamped with "Clous de Paris", featuring a medallion carrying the brand logo.
Also available in midnight blue or white.
